I think I already know the answer to this one, but here goes...
I have a '91 Legacy L - non turbo, AWD, automatic trans. Accelerating mildly, I felt a pretty severe clunk at around 40mph. Now, it seems to be stuck in third gear! Neutral and park still seem effective, though nothing else does - reverse doesn't work (engine revs but car stays put) and when the lever is in 'first', it definitely isn't in that gear.
Before this, there were signs that the tranny was on its last legs (less than 100k miles on it though). A recent fluid flush didn't help. It has a slight shudder when accelerating, up until around 40mph. Shifting is a bit slow at times, possibly related to torque convertor lock-up.
Is there any hope of salvaging what's there and getting this car to limp along for another few months, or do I pretty much have to replace the tranny?
